Chocolate Toxicity
Easter is a time that most of us look forward to, allowing us guilt free consumption of lots of CHOCOLATE. Our pets, particularly dogs also have a sweet tooth for chocolate. Unfortunately for them, Ingestion of chocolate can be life-threatening. Clinical signs of chocolate toxicity include: :hyperactivity :anxiousness :vomiting :diarrhoea :abnormal heart rhythms. Ear Care
During this time of the year we are seeing increasing number of ear infections due to the humidity and allergies. At the Lake Veterinary Hospital we believe preventive care is the best tool to stop causes advancing to infection and causing discomfort to your furry friends. Any dog can get an ear infection.
